Download
Getting Started
Members
Projects
Community
Marketplace
Events
Planet Eclipse
Newsletter
Videos
Participate
Report a Bug
Forums
Mailing Lists
Wiki
IRC
How to Contribute
Working Groups
Automotive
Internet of Things
LocationTech
Long-Term Support
PolarSys
Science
OpenMDM
More
Community
Marketplace
Events
Planet Eclipse
Newsletter
Videos
Participate
Report a Bug
Forums
Mailing Lists
Wiki
IRC
How to Contribute
Working Groups
Automotive
Internet of Things
LocationTech
Long-Term Support
PolarSys
Science
OpenMDM
Toggle navigation
Bugzilla – Attachment 154102 Details for
Bug 295842
JPA tests: Make database platform and weaving properties explicit in persistence.xml
Home
|
New
|
Browse
|
Search
|
[?]
|
Reports
|
Requests
|
Help
|
Log In
[x]
|
Terms of Use
|
Copyright Agent
[patch]
Patch containing one additional persistence.xml file as suggested by Kevin
bugzilla295842_20091209.patch (text/plain), 10.41 KB, created by
Adrian Goerler
on 2009-12-09 05:59:24 EST
(
hide
)
Description:
Patch containing one additional persistence.xml file as suggested by Kevin
Filename:
MIME Type:
Creator:
Adrian Goerler
Created:
2009-12-09 05:59:24 EST
Size:
10.41 KB
patch
obsolete
>Index: jpa/eclipselink.jpa.test/build.xml >=================================================================== >--- jpa/eclipselink.jpa.test/build.xml (revision 6010) >+++ jpa/eclipselink.jpa.test/build.xml (working copy) >@@ -1554,6 +1554,12 @@ > <replace dir="${eclipselink.jpa.test}/stage/META-INF" token='%%data-source-name%%' value="${DS_NAME}"> > <include name="*.xml"/> > </replace> >+ <replace dir="${eclipselink.jpa.test}/stage/META-INF" token='%%server-weaving%%' value="${server.weaving}"> >+ <include name="*.xml"/> >+ </replace> >+ <replace dir="${eclipselink.jpa.test}/stage/META-INF" token='%%database-platform%%' value="${db.platform}"> >+ <include name="*.xml"/> >+ </replace> > > <!-- Copy the canonical metamodel and criteria api test --> > <antcall target="copy_criteria_api_canonical_model" inheritRefs="true"/> >Index: jpa/eclipselink.jpa.test/resource/eclipselink-advanced-field-access-model/server/persistence.xml >=================================================================== >--- jpa/eclipselink.jpa.test/resource/eclipselink-advanced-field-access-model/server/persistence.xml (revision 6010) >+++ jpa/eclipselink.jpa.test/resource/eclipselink-advanced-field-access-model/server/persistence.xml (working copy) >@@ -7,9 +7,9 @@ > <!--This property is added to test 'querytimeout' property and test is > implemented in 'EntityManagerJUnitTestSuite.testQueryTimeOut()'--> > <property name="javax.persistence.query.timeout" value="100"/> >- <!--property name="eclipselink.weaving" value="true"/> >- <property name="eclipselink.weaving" value="static"/--> >+ <property name="eclipselink.weaving" value="%%server-weaving%%"/> > <property name="eclipselink.target-server" value="%%server-platform%%"/> >+ <property name="eclipselink.target-database" value="%%database-platform%%"/> > <property name="eclipselink.validate-existence" value="true"/> > <!--property name="eclipselink.logging.level" value="FINEST"/--> > </properties> >Index: jpa/eclipselink.jpa.test/resource/eclipselink-advanced-model/server/persistence.xml >=================================================================== >--- jpa/eclipselink.jpa.test/resource/eclipselink-advanced-model/server/persistence.xml (revision 6010) >+++ jpa/eclipselink.jpa.test/resource/eclipselink-advanced-model/server/persistence.xml (working copy) >@@ -4,10 +4,12 @@ > <jta-data-source>%%data-source-name%%</jta-data-source> > <properties> > <property name="eclipselink.target-server" value="%%server-platform%%"/> >+ <property name="eclipselink.target-database" value="%%database-platform%%"/> > <property name="eclipselink.validate-existence" value="true"/> > <property name="eclipselink.descriptor.customizer.Employee" value="org.eclipse.persistence.testing.models.jpa.advanced.Customizer"/> > <property name="eclipselink.descriptor.customizer.org.eclipse.persistence.testing.models.jpa.advanced.Address" value="org.eclipse.persistence.testing.models.jpa.advanced.Customizer"/> > <property name="eclipselink.descriptor.customizer.Project" value="org.eclipse.persistence.testing.models.jpa.advanced.Customizer"/> >+ <property name="eclipselink.weaving" value="%%server-weaving%%"/> > <!--property name="eclipselink.logging.level" value="FINEST"/--> > </properties> > </persistence-unit> >Index: jpa/eclipselink.jpa.test/resource/eclipselink-advanced-properties/server/persistence.xml >=================================================================== >--- jpa/eclipselink.jpa.test/resource/eclipselink-advanced-properties/server/persistence.xml (revision 6010) >+++ jpa/eclipselink.jpa.test/resource/eclipselink-advanced-properties/server/persistence.xml (working copy) >@@ -6,6 +6,7 @@ > <exclude-unlisted-classes>false</exclude-unlisted-classes> > <properties> > <property name="eclipselink.target-server" value="%%server-platform%%"/> >+ <property name="eclipselink.target-database" value="%%database-platform%%"/> > <property name="eclipselink.sessions-xml" value="META-INF/sessions.xml"/> > <property name="eclipselink.session-name" value="JPASessionXML"/> > <property name="eclipselink.exception-handler" value="org.eclipse.persistence.testing.tests.jpa.jpaadvancedproperties.CustomizedExceptionHandler"/> >@@ -19,6 +20,7 @@ > <property name="eclipselink.logging.file" value="JPAAdvancedProperties.log"/> > <property name="eclipselink.session.include.descriptor.queries" value="true"/> > <property name="eclipselink.profiler" value="NoProfiler"/> >+ <property name="eclipselink.weaving" value="%%server-weaving%%"/> > > </properties> > </persistence-unit> >Index: jpa/eclipselink.jpa.test/resource/eclipselink-customfeatures-model/server/persistence.xml >=================================================================== >--- jpa/eclipselink.jpa.test/resource/eclipselink-customfeatures-model/server/persistence.xml (revision 6010) >+++ jpa/eclipselink.jpa.test/resource/eclipselink-customfeatures-model/server/persistence.xml (working copy) >@@ -4,8 +4,10 @@ > <jta-data-source>%%data-source-name%%</jta-data-source> > <properties> > <property name="eclipselink.target-server" value="%%server-platform%%"/> >+ <property name="eclipselink.target-database" value="%%database-platform%%"/> > <!--property name="eclipselink.logging.level" value="FINEST"/--> > <property name="eclipselink.jdbc.batch-writing" value="Oracle-JDBC"/> >+ <property name="eclipselink.weaving" value="%%server-weaving%%"/> > </properties> > </persistence-unit> > </persistence> >Index: jpa/eclipselink.jpa.test/resource/eclipselink-ddl-generation-model/server/persistence.xml >=================================================================== >--- jpa/eclipselink.jpa.test/resource/eclipselink-ddl-generation-model/server/persistence.xml (revision 6010) >+++ jpa/eclipselink.jpa.test/resource/eclipselink-ddl-generation-model/server/persistence.xml (working copy) >@@ -11,7 +11,9 @@ > > <properties> > <property name="eclipselink.target-server" value="%%server-platform%%"/> >+ <property name="eclipselink.target-database" value="%%database-platform%%"/> > <property name="eclipselink.ddl-generation" value="drop-and-create-tables"/> >+ <property name="eclipselink.weaving" value="%%server-weaving%%"/> > </properties> > </persistence-unit> > </persistence> >Index: jpa/eclipselink.jpa.test/resource/eclipselink-ddl-generation-model/server_merge-inherited/persistence.xml >=================================================================== >--- jpa/eclipselink.jpa.test/resource/eclipselink-ddl-generation-model/server_merge-inherited/persistence.xml (revision 6010) >+++ jpa/eclipselink.jpa.test/resource/eclipselink-ddl-generation-model/server_merge-inherited/persistence.xml (working copy) >@@ -15,6 +15,8 @@ > <properties> > <property name="eclipselink.target-server" value="%%server-platform%%"/> > <property name="eclipselink.ddl-generation" value="drop-and-create-tables"/> >+ <property name="eclipselink.weaving" value="%%server-weaving%%"/> >+ <property name="eclipselink.target-database" value="%%database-platform%%"/> > </properties> > </persistence-unit> > </persistence> >Index: jpa/eclipselink.jpa.test/resource/eclipselink-delimited-model/server/persistence.xml >=================================================================== >--- jpa/eclipselink.jpa.test/resource/eclipselink-delimited-model/server/persistence.xml (revision 6010) >+++ jpa/eclipselink.jpa.test/resource/eclipselink-delimited-model/server/persistence.xml (working copy) >@@ -5,9 +5,9 @@ > <exclude-unlisted-classes>false</exclude-unlisted-classes> > <properties> > <property name="eclipselink.ddl-generation" value="drop-and-create-tables"/> >- <!--property name="eclipselink.weaving" value="true"/> >- <property name="eclipselink.weaving" value="static"/--> >+ <property name="eclipselink.weaving" value="%%server-weaving%%"/> > <property name="eclipselink.target-server" value="%%server-platform%%"/> >+ <property name="eclipselink.target-database" value="%%database-platform%%"/> > <property name="eclipselink.validate-existence" value="true"/> > <!--property name="eclipselink.logging.level" value="FINEST"/--> > </properties> >Index: jpa/eclipselink.jpa.test/resource/eclipselink-xml-servertest-model/server/persistence.xml >=================================================================== >--- jpa/eclipselink.jpa.test/resource/eclipselink-xml-servertest-model/server/persistence.xml (revision 6010) >+++ jpa/eclipselink.jpa.test/resource/eclipselink-xml-servertest-model/server/persistence.xml (working copy) >@@ -14,8 +14,10 @@ > <exclude-unlisted-classes>false</exclude-unlisted-classes> > <properties> > <property name="eclipselink.target-server" value="%%server-platform%%"/> >+ <property name="eclipselink.target-database" value="%%database-platform%%"/> > <property name="eclipselink.validate-existence" value="true"/> > <property name="eclipselink.orm.validate.schema" value="true"/> >+ <property name="eclipselink.weaving" value="%%server-weaving%%"/> > </properties> > </persistence-unit> > </persistence> >Index: jpa/eclipselink.jpa.test/resource/server/persistence.xml >=================================================================== >--- jpa/eclipselink.jpa.test/resource/server/persistence.xml (revision 6010) >+++ jpa/eclipselink.jpa.test/resource/server/persistence.xml (working copy) >@@ -4,8 +4,10 @@ > <jta-data-source>%%data-source-name%%</jta-data-source> > <properties> > <property name="eclipselink.target-server" value="%%server-platform%%"/> >+ <property name="eclipselink.target-database" value="%%database-platform%%"/> > <property name="eclipselink.validate-existence" value="true"/> > <!--property name="eclipselink.logging.level" value="FINEST"/--> >+ <property name="eclipselink.weaving" value="%%server-weaving%%"/> > </properties> > </persistence-unit> > </persistence>
You cannot view the attachment while viewing its details because your browser does not support IFRAMEs.
View the attachment on a separate page
.
View Attachment As Diff
View Attachment As Raw
Actions:
View
|
Diff
Attachments on
bug 295842
:
152834
| 154102